Title :
Digital signature with a threshold subliminal channel
Author :
Lee, Narn-Yih ; Ho, Pei-Hsiu
Author_Institution :
Dept. of Information Manage., Southern Taiwan Univ. of Technol., Tainan, Taiwan
Abstract :
Simmons first proposed the concept of subliminal channel in 1983. Since then, many subliminal channels based on digital signatures are proposed. A (t,n) threshold scheme allows a secret to be shared among n users so that only t or more users can reconstruct the secret. In this paper, we combine both concepts to propose the first threshold subliminal channel which can convey a subliminal message to a group of users. Deriving the subliminal message relies on the cooperation of t or more users in the group. Moreover, the validation of the subliminal message can be verified in the scheme.
